Updated Phase I/II data presented at ENDO 2026 suggest subcutaneous MHB018A was associated with proptosis and diplopia responses in patients with active and chronic thyroid eye disease.


MHB018A, a novel subcutaneously administered VHH antibody targeting insulin-like growth factor 1 receptor, has shown clinical activity in both active and chronic thyroid eye disease (TED), according to updated Phase I/II data presented at ENDO 2026.¹

TED is an autoimmune inflammatory disorder affecting the orbit and is most commonly associated with Graves’ disease. It can cause eyelid retraction, proptosis, diplopia, ocular surface disease and, in more severe cases, dysthyroid optic neuropathy.²,³ For ophthalmologists, TED management often involves monitoring disease activity, assessing visual function and ocular motility, managing exposure-related symptoms and coordinating care with endocrinology and oculoplastics teams. Although treatment options have advanced, there remains a need for effective and practical therapies that can address disease burden across both active and chronic stages.

MHB018A is designed to inhibit IGF-1R signalling, including IGF-1- and IGF-2-mediated pathways. The Phase I/II study included a double-blind, randomized phase and an open-label expansion. In the randomized phase, patients with active TED were assigned to MHB018A or placebo across three dose cohorts: 300 mg every 4 weeks, a 600 mg loading dose followed by 300 mg every 4 weeks, or 450 mg every 4 weeks. The expansion phase evaluated fixed 300 mg and 450 mg doses in patients with active or chronic TED.¹

Overall, 71 patients with active TED and 33 patients with chronic TED were enrolled. Patients with active TED received three doses over 12 weeks. At Week 12, proptosis response rates were 56% with 300 mg, 50% with the 600 mg loading dose followed by 300 mg, and 81% with 450 mg every 4 weeks. Secondary efficacy endpoints also favoured the 450 mg dose.¹

At the 450 mg every 4 weeks dose, patients with active TED achieved a mean proptosis change of -2.83 mm at Week 12. A Clinical Activity Score of 0 or 1 was reported in 84% of patients, while overall response, diplopia response and complete diplopia resolution were reported in 78%, 85% and 59% of patients, respectively.¹

In patients with chronic TED treated with 450 mg every 4 weeks, MHB018A achieved a proptosis response of 76% at Week 24, with a mean change from baseline of -2.65 mm. Among patients with diplopia at baseline, 61% achieved a diplopia response and 50% had complete diplopia resolution.¹

MHB018A was generally well tolerated across the study population. Most adverse events were mild and consistent with the expected effects of IGF-1R inhibition. No serious adverse events or severe hearing-related adverse events were reported, and all hearing-related adverse events were Grade 1, with no severe or permanent hearing damage observed.¹,⁴

Guoqing Cao, PhD, Chief Executive Officer of Minghui Pharmaceutical, said the Phase I/II results showed improvements in proptosis and diplopia across active and chronic TED, as well as a high proportion of patients with active TED achieving low inflammatory activity scores. He also highlighted the potential role of subcutaneous administration in future clinical use.⁴

MHB018A is currently being evaluated in ongoing Phase III trials in China, with topline results anticipated in Q3 2026. Global Phase III trials have also been initiated, with first patient enrolment targeted for Q4 2026.⁴
